For Windows NT 4. 0/Windows 2000/Windows XP

When the printer is not printing

Cause

Verification

Action

Incorrect IP address.

Ask your network

administrator to check

that the IP address is

correct.

Specify the correct IP

address for the printer.

When [LPD Spool] is set

to [Memory], the print

data sent from a

computer in a single

print instruction has

exceeded the upper limit

of the receiving capacity.

Check the memory

capacity of [LPD Spool]

and compare it with the

print data which was

sent in the single print

instruction.

1. If a single file of print

data has exceeded the

upper limit of the

memory capacity, divide

the file into smaller ones

and try again.

2. If multiple files have

exceeded the upper limit

of memory capacity,

reduce the number of

files to be sent at one

time.

An irrecoverable error

has occurred during

printing.

Check if an error is

displayed on the control

panel.

Switch off and then on

the printer.

The transport protocol is

different from that of the

computer.

Check the selected

transport protocol.

Select the same

transport protocol as

that of the computer.
